Why do we know so little about the Indus Valley Civilization?
We havent been able to translate their language
What advantage did the Egyptian farmers have over those in Mesopotamia?
The Nile overflows on a predictable basis, whereas the Tigris and the Euphrates flood on a random basis
What is feudalism? What problem did it creat for China?
Fedualism: When the king gave land to the nobles in exchange for military service. Instead of strengthening the king, it strengthened the nobles and caused conflict
What are the advantages and disadvantages of Chinese writing?
The Chinese could communicate in writing if they had a different dialect; there were so many symbols, so it was hard to remember
What was the "Mandate of Heaven" and what effect did it have on China's government?
The "Mandate of Heaven" gave authority to someone from God. It led to a dynastic rule when someone would overthrow someone by claiming of having the "Mandate of Heaven"
What are the Principles of Hammurabi's Code?
1.) Principles of retaliation
2.) Principle that people should be treated differently by the law
3.) Principle that the gov't has certain responsibilities for the welfare of its people
4.) Principle of rule by law, not whim
Illustration of the Principles of retaliation
If a man has knocked out the eye of a patrician; his eye shall be knocked out
illustration of the principle that people should be treated differently by the law
If [a woman] has not been discreet, has gone out, ruined her house, belittled her husband; she shall be drowned
Illustration of the principle that the gov't has certain responsibilities for the welfare of its people
If a life [has been lost], the city or district governor shall pay one mina of silver to the deceased relatives
Illustration of the principle of rule by law, not whim
